Ho appena concluso l’esame di Informatica Teorica.
Per questo esame, a parte la teoria, ci è stato chiesto di implementare uno scanner, un parser e un piccolo interprete di un linguaggio che rispecchiasse le specifiche date qui.
Io il mio lavoro l’ho fatto anche se ho sbagliato un paio di cose. La più grave, che ha pregiudicato il mio voto, è la creazione dell’operatore “parallelo”.
Si doveva creare un operatore che parallelizzasse le istruzioni che gli si passavano. Io ne ho creato uno che parallelizzava l’interpretazione di blocchi di istruzioni, mentre il prof. richiedeva la parallelizzazione delle singole istruzioni anche se contenute in più bocchi. Comunque il voto era tempo di prenderlo per non sprofondare negli abissi e quindi ho accettato.
Ora, dopo questa instroduzione da cui non si è capito nulla vi lascio ai link della relazione e dei sorgeti, del codice e dei file di prova.
Sorgenti : Sorgenti, file di prova, file scanner.jar per l’esecuzione a riga di comando
Posted under Informatica Generale, JAVA, Linguaggi di Programmazione, WPF
This post was written by Filippo on March 26, 2007


Bravo prima di tutto, ma no anzi, bravissimo! Quanto hai preso alla fine? (Non vedo l’ora di consegnare anch’io…)
Non riesco a scaricare i sorgenti.. non ho user e pass. Anche io sto facendo questo maledetto elaborato e volevo dare un’occhiata al tuo, se è possibile.
Grazie mille, ora va:)
ti ha abbassato molto il voto alla fine per l’errore che avevi commesso?
sto facendo anche io l’elaborato …
le specifiche dell’elaborato del 2007/2008 cambiano di molto? sai qualcosa?
grazie ciao
Si, in effetti mi ha abbassato di molto.
Quindi ti consiglio di reimplementare almeno la parte di codice che riguarda l’operazione “parallelo”.
A quanto sentivo dire da qualcuno che lo stava facendo adesso le specifiche non sono cambiate. Ma per quello ti conviene farti un giro sul dito del proff e dell’assistente.